About Me:
My name is Stephanie Tisseman, a costume designer with a love for storytelling, detail, and historical fashion.
I’m currently studying costume design and have worked on a variety of make-believe projects, from stage productions like Mansfield Park and Suit Sleuth, to fantasy-inspired concepts based on A Court of Thorns and Roses.
My work often focuses on exploring character through silhouette, texture, and embellishment—whether it’s building a period-accurate millinery piece or creating something surreal and emotionally rich from paper or wool.
I have a particular interest in historical and fantasy-based costume, and I enjoy experimenting with traditional techniques like embroidery, weaving, and draping. I’m always inspired by the challenge of bringing characters to life through fabric and form—especially when I can use research to shape every creative choice.
